Taro Kida, a multi-talented man known for many years as " Mozart of Naniwa" and also known for composing the hit song "Aho no Sakata' passed away on May 14th. He was 93.
In particular, from the 1970s to the 1980s, he created timeless melodies that anyone who lived through the Showa era could hum, including theme songs for hugely popular TV programs such as "2ji no Wide Show," "Proposal Daisakusen," and "Love Attack!," as well as commercial songs for "Chicken Ramen," "Demae Iccho," and "Koyama Yuenchi," which became synonymous with Kinzo Sakura.
